Indian Predator: The Diary Of A Serial Killer

A Netflix original crime thriller documentary series revolves around gruesome cannibalism and a psycho serial killer who first comes under the radar for killing a journalist. 

The official synopsis of the series read: "When a young, well-loved journalist goes missing in Allahabad, the entire community comes together to unearth the truth. In the process, they find an unlikely suspect — a small-time local politician’s husband. Just when the police think the case is closed, they find a diary that has a list of 13 names along with that of the dead journalist."

Where To Watch: Netflix

Release date: 7 September 2022

Thor: Love and Thunder

Sequel to Thor: Ragnarok, Thor: Love and Thunder is the 29th film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U). The movie follows Thor's efforts to stop Gorr the God Butcher from eliminating all gods with help of his long-lost lover. The film stars Chris Hemsworth, Natalie Portman, Christian Bale, Tessa Thompson, Jaimie Alexander and Russell Crowe in key roles.

Where To Watch: Disney Plus Hotstar

Release date: 8 September 2022

Paappan

This Malayalam language crime thriller tells the story of Abraham Mathew Mathan, a voluntarily retired officer and his daughter unwillingly reinstated to the force for investigating a murder case. The film stars Suresh Gopi, Neeta Pillai, Gokul Suresh, Asha Sharath, Nyla Usha and Kaniha in the lead.

Where To Watch: Zee5

Release date: 7 September 2022

Sita Ramam

Dulquer Salmaan and Mrunal Thakur starrer Sita Ramam is period romantic drama. Loved by audiences across the nation, ‘Sita Ramam’ tells the mysterious love story of Lieutenant Ram (Dulquer), an orphan soldier whose life changes after receiving a letter from Sita (Mrunal). Helmed by Hanu Raghavapudi the film also stars Rashmika Mandanna, and Sumanth in key roles.
Sita Ramam will be streaming on Amazon Prime in Telugu along with Malayalam and Tamil. 

Where To Watch: Amazon Prime Video

Release date: 9 September 2022

Ek Villain Returns

Mohit Suri's Ek Villain Returns will stream on Netflix. The film starring John Abraham, Arjun Kapoor, Disha Patani and Tara Sutaria had released in cinemas end of July this year. The movie revolves around a cab driver who goes on a killing spree, with his girlfriend’s aid, in the name of the Smiley Killer.

Where To Watch: Netflix

Release date: 9 September 2022
